GOOD CONDITION STAND announces September lineup, with Tiels Brewing TTO on Sept. 5
GOOD CONDITION STAND, a beer pub in Shin-Ohashi, Koto, Tokyo, has announced its September schedule. The venue will celebrate its second anniversary with a five-day event from September 1 to 5, capped by a tap takeover from Tiels Brewing on September 5.

Second-anniversary week
- Orion Beer: 790 yen normally, 600 yen during the event
- "Fate beer roulette": 1,500 yen for the large size / 1,000 yen for the small size
- Free popcorn
- Guests are welcome to bring celebratory drinks to share
The bar is closed on Sundays and Mondays. For Silver Week holidays, it plans to open a bit earlier than usual.
Sept. 5: Tiels Brewing tap takeover
On Saturday, September 5, the final day of the anniversary week, Tiels Brewing from Mishima, Shizuoka will host a tap takeover. The highlight is "Watermelon & Berry Smoothie Beer," a beer that was brewed last year and then aged for one year. The venue says brewer-owner Akita will also be visiting, making it a fitting celebration for a beer bar that keeps a close connection with breweries and guests.
More collabs later in the month
On Saturday, September 19, the bar plans a joint pop-up with Shappobana and Zettai! Yamaimo Steak Naru. On Friday, September 25, it will host another collaboration with Jiji Udon, now a regular feature at the venue.
